Comprehensive Guide to Employee Contract

Understanding the Employee Contract Agreement

The Employee Contract Agreement serves a crucial role in establishing clear employment terms, ensuring both employees and employers understand their obligations. This legal document defines the terms of employment, including job responsibilities and compensation. A written contract is essential for both parties, as it provides a reference point for expectations and protects against misunderstandings.
Typically, an employee contract agreement includes essential details such as the role's title, specific responsibilities, salary, and benefits. Given its importance, having a secure and clear document can greatly enhance the employer-employee relationship.

Purpose and Benefits of Using the Employee Contract Agreement

Employing an Employee Contract Agreement offers numerous advantages to both parties involved. It clarifies the expectations and responsibilities that each party must adhere to throughout the employment period. This method safeguards the rights of both the employer and employee, providing legal recourse in case of disputes.
By outlining compensation and benefits clearly, such agreements significantly reduce the potential for misunderstandings, ensuring a smoother employment experience.

Key Features of the Employee Contract Agreement

The Employee Contract Agreement includes several essential features necessary for legal compliance and clarity. Key elements often consist of:
  • Multiple fillable fields such as Name, Address, Telephone No., and Salary
  • Signature lines for both parties to validate the agreement legally
  • Definitions of important terms like confidentiality agreements and conditions for termination
These features ensure that the document meets legal standards while being user-friendly for both employers and employees.
